Emmeline Pankhurst's full name was Emmeline Goulden Pankhurst. She was born on July 15, 1858, in Manchester, England, and is best known for her role in the women's suffrage movement. Pankhurst founded the Women's Social and Political Union (WSPU) and was a key figure in advocating for women's right to vote in the early 20th century. She passed away on June 14, 1928.
